NC-Congress sweeps Kargil polls, wins 22 seats
Srinagar, Oct 08 (KNO): The National Conference and Congress have swept the Ladakh Autonomous Hill Development Council- Kargil polls by winning 22 out of 26 seats.
As per result available with news agency—Kashmir News Observer (KNO), NC won 12 seats while its ally Congress emerged victorious on 10 seats.
BJP and independents emerged victorious on two seats each. This was the first election in Kargil after August 5, 2019—(KNO)
